1971 AC 428 Fastback by Frua
- Engine
- 7.0L (428 ci) OHV Ford V8, four-barrel carburetor, 345 bhp at 3,400 rpm, automatic transmission
- Colour
- Silver

Chassis CF60 is a 1971 AC 428 Fastback with coachwork by Pietro Frua, one of only 51 such coupes produced between 1966 and 1973. Powered by its original 428-cubic-inch Ford V8 paired with a C6 automatic gearbox, the car displays approximately 32,000 recorded miles. Imported from Switzerland into the United States in 1985, it passed to its long-term American owner in 1997 and received comprehensive refurbishment work in 2015 and again in 2021, emerging in silver over black leather with chrome wire wheels.
Ownership
- 2021-08-13Auction saleSold US$155,000
- → 1985Swiss ownerpartial documentation
Car was based in Switzerland prior to 1985 export; no further details on this owner are provided.
- 1985 → 1997Private saleJim Feldmanpartial documentation
Portland, Oregon-based AC marque authority who arranged importation of the car from Switzerland via the Belgian port of Antwerp; sold the car to the current owner in mid-1997.
- 1997-07-01 →Private saleCurrent consignorfull documentation
First became aware of the car in late 1985 before completing purchase in July 1997; undertook substantial refurbishment in 2015 and further work in 2021, including cooling system and rear suspension upgrades.

Maintenance & restoration
- 2015Restoration
Comprehensive refurbishment carried out under the current owner's direction, bringing the car to a high standard while preserving its original character.
- 2021Mechanical
Most recent round of additional mechanical and cosmetic work performed to maintain the car in top-echelon condition.
- —Modification
The factory Kenlowe cooling fans were disconnected and replaced with a modern high-capacity electric fan fitted behind the radiator to address inadequate engine cooling.
- —ModificationShawn Thomas
An upgraded rear-suspension kit sourced from Andy Shepherd at Uniclip Automotive was fitted to improve handling dynamics.
Kit supplied by Uniclip Automotive; installation carried out by Shawn Thomas.
